Baby Zionov Drops Single 'Clubbing In The Time Of Cholera'

Bringing together elements of Chicago house, vintage space disco and even Sonic The Hedgehog, Tāmaki Makaurau electronic artist Baby Zionov, the musical alias of Aaliyah Zionov, gives us new single 'Clubbing In The Time Of Cholera'. Described by the singer / producer on 95bFM yesterday as "a song about getting ready to go to a party" and sub-titled 'A Musical Tribute to a Bygone Era in Which People Sometimes Had Parties to Go To, Although Sometimes They Didn't', the spine-tingling track is a first taste of her forthcoming debut EP ...And You Are The Bitch, dropping in late June via rising Aotearoa imprint Sunreturn, who've also recently released tunes by Amamelia, Green Grove and Dateline. 'Clubbing In The Time Of Cholera' perfectly captures and possibly even amplifies the excitement of prepping for a night on the dance floor, where sometimes the warmup is equally as fun as the main event.

Sporting killer artwork by Benny Matthews (Worn Out, Caveman Noise), we have no doubt Baby Zionov's EP will encourage club-goers to ponder the politics of dancing while succumbing to the rhythm of the night. You can catch Baby Zionov celebrating her new single's release online this Saturday, at a special Zoom party featuring Amamelia, Girl_irl (USA), Princess Richard, Shallows and Totems.
